Output 89dfc7a7517cde445ef65e392fcb6ba8f10f7fbf9e842d5835a69913e3d5491b:5

value
563280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d505fbeb8ae1044139c6e488d87a1fe0d02ae822 OP_EQUAL
address
3M7P2BbuuhFdb1pzpipNPUBBAXJ3ZZKE55
transaction
89dfc7a7517cde445ef65e392fcb6ba8f10f7fbf9e842d5835a69913e3d5491b
spent
true